AdMob Plus 项目常见问题解决方案

1. 项目基础介绍和主要编程语言

AdMob Plus 是一个适用于 Cordova、Capacitor、Ionic 和 React Native 的可信 AdMob 插件。它提供了一个干净的 API,并且使用现代工具构建。该项目旨在提供一个无广告共享、无远程控制、完全开源并且维护良好的 AdMob 解决方案。AdMob Plus 适用于移动应用 monetization,支持多种编程语言,其中主要的编程语言包括:

  • TypeScript
  • Swift
  • Kotlin
  • Java
  • JavaScript
  • MDX

2. 新手使用时需特别注意的问题及解决步骤

问题一:如何集成 AdMob Plus 到项目中?

解决步骤:

  1. 确保你的项目已经安装了 Cordova、Capacitor、Ionic 或 React Native。

  2. 使用 npm 或 yarn 安装 AdMob Plus 插件。

    npm install admob-plus
    

    或者

    yarn add admob-plus
    
  3. 根据你的项目类型,运行相应的命令来添加 AdMob Plus 插件。

    对于 Cordova 项目:

    cordova plugin add admob-plus
    

    对于 Capacitor 项目:

    npm install @capacitor/admob
    npm run cap sync
    
  4. 按照项目文档中的说明配置 AdMob Plus。

问题二:如何显示广告?

解决步骤:

  1. 在你的项目中引入 AdMob Plus 模块。

    对于 React Native 项目:

    import AdMob from 'admob-plus';
    
  2. 初始化 AdMob Plus 并设置广告 ID。

    AdMob.bannerConfig({
      adId: 'YOUR_BANNER_AD_ID',
      adSize: 'SMART_BANNER'
    });
    
  3. 显示广告。

    AdMob.showBanner();
    

问题三:如何处理广告事件和错误?

解决步骤:

  1. 为广告事件和错误设置监听器。

    AdMob.addEventListener('onAdLoaded', () => {
      console.log('广告加载完成');
    });
    
    AdMob.addEventListener('onAdFailedToLoad', (error) => {
      console.error('广告加载失败:', error);
    });
    
    // 其他事件如 'onAdOpened', 'onAdClosed', 'onAdLeftApplication' 等也可以添加监听
    
  2. 在适当的位置调用监听器。

    例如,在广告加载后,你可以在监听器中显示广告。

通过遵循上述步骤,新手用户可以更顺利地集成和使用 AdMob Plus 项目。

Logo

开源鸿蒙跨平台开发社区汇聚开发者与厂商,共建“一次开发,多端部署”的开源生态,致力于降低跨端开发门槛,推动万物智联创新。

更多推荐